  2. Airvh Active Member

    Unless your laptop has a touch screen then I would suggest to change this option:
    1 x Operating System ( Windows 8 + Office 2010 Trial [Free 60-Day !!!] - 64-bit )
    to: Windows 7
    EQ2 runs fine on Windows 8. However many options in 8 have been changed that just make 8 harder to use than 7. Example: when you want to shut down the computer 7 would have you click the start menu and choose shut down. Can't do that in 8, you gotta find your way to settings, then choose power, then choose to shut down.
